Unemployment is a persistent economic challenge, and some argue that rapid urbanisation is the only effective response. I largely disagree with this claim. While urban growth can generate employment, treating it as the exclusive solution ignores structural causes of joblessness and risks creating additional social and economic pressures.

Urbanisation can reduce unemployment by concentrating investment, infrastructure, and labour markets in cities. Expanding transport, housing, and services creates construction and service jobs, while dense urban centres attract firms that benefit from skilled labour and efficient supply chains. In practice, industrial zones near major cities often absorb rural migrants into manufacturing and logistics roles, especially during periods of sustained public and private development.

However, relying exclusively on rapid urban growth is neither sufficient nor sustainable. Without parallel investment in education, vocational training, and regional development, cities may face underemployment, informal work, and overcrowding. Moreover, rural areas and small towns lose human capital, weakening agriculture and local enterprises. Policies that promote skills development, digital work, and decentralised industries can create employment opportunities across regions without imposing excessive urban strain.

In conclusion, urbanisation can contribute meaningfully to employment creation, but it is not the only effective way to tackle unemployment. A balanced strategy that combines managed urban growth with skills training and regional economic diversification is more likely to deliver stable and inclusive employment outcomes over the long term.
